Your divorce procedure relies on 1) whether both you and your spouse want the separation (disputed or uncontested) 2) what you really have to divide or exercise. My partner as well as I both want a separation. What should we do initially? If both you and also your partner are in agreement that you want a separation, after that you have an uncontested divorce.

If partners authorize a sworn statement of approval, they might obtain premises for a divorce after the passage of a necessary 90-day ceasefire agreement. If one spouse does not agree to the divorce, they need to have lived different and apart for a minimum of (1) year from the day of declaring prior to premises for a separation can be developed.
